Why Carson Homes Are Different
Carson’s residential streets were largely built in two waves, right after WWII and through the 1960s and 70s around the city’s 1968 incorporation. Most of the wrought-iron and chain-link gates here were added later, in the 80s and 90s, by homeowners who wanted security but hired whoever was cheapest that week. Those aftermarket retrofits often have shallow posts, mismatched hinges, and hardware that was never rated for coastal exposure. Add the marine salt air drifting in from San Pedro Bay plus petroleum particulates from the refinery corridor to the north, and you get a corrosion environment that shortens the life of mild-steel gate components faster than in Torrance or Lomita. The result is a city full of gates that sag, bind, rust through, and strain whatever motor gets bolted onto them.

Weld Repair
Carson’s residential gates were often welded by whoever was available when the house changed hands. Those welds were sometimes shallow, sometimes made with the wrong rod for the metal, and after forty years near the port they crack. A typical weld repair with corrosion treatment and protective coating runs $350-$550 depending on access and how much of the frame needs attention. In neighborhoods like Carriage Crest off Avalon Boulevard, we regularly see original 1980s welds failing at the hinge plates, and the fix is almost always a full grind-out and re-weld rather than a cosmetic patch.
Rust Treatment
The combination of marine salt air from the Port of Long Beach, less than five miles away, and refinery particulates from the corridor north of the 405 gives Carson a corrosion profile we do not see in more sheltered cities. Unpainted wrought iron here can show pitting within two years. Our rust treatment removes scaled oxidation, applies a phosphate conversion coating, then a zinc-rich primer and industrial enamel. It is not a paint job, it is a repair, and it typically ranges $350-$550 as part of a larger weld or hardware job.
Gate Realignment
Original 1960s and 70s swing gates in Carson sag and scrape pavement because the concrete footings were poured for a manual gate, not an operator. Clay soil expands with winter rain, posts lean, and a gate that hung true in 1985 drags the driveway by 2025. Gate realignment with post stabilization usually falls between $280-$450. We check whether the problem is hinge wear, post settlement, or frame distortion before recommending anything, and we will not sell you a new gate when realignment solves the problem.

Motor Repair
The most common residential call is a motor that hums but will not move the gate, usually a stripped gear, a seized capacitor, or a chain that jumped its sprocket. Residential motor repair in Carson runs $180-$450. Near the port, we also see control-board failures from condensation inside poorly sealed operator housings, and we carry replacement boards for Linear, Viking, and DoorKing units on the truck.
Commercial Slide Motor Replacement
The logistics parks in Dominguez Hills push slide gates through 300-500 cycles a day. A residential-grade opener installed to win a bid will overheat, trip its thermal cutoff, and cook its own windings within months. Commercial slide motor replacement in Carson starts at $1,200 and runs to $3,800 for industrial-duty units sized to the actual workload.

Post Replacement
When a post leans, the gate binds, the operator strains, and something fails, usually the post or the gearbox. Post replacement in Carson typically costs $450-$850, which includes pulling the old post, pouring a new footing to proper depth, and welding the hardware square. One crew handles the concrete and the welding in a single visit.
